1. Product Overview

The Skunk2 Alpha Series Connecting Rods, model 306-05-1160, are engineered for high-performance applications in Honda B16A Engines. These rods are forged from high-quality 4340 chromoly steel, featuring a robust H-beam design that optimizes strength-to-weight ratio. Each rod undergoes comprehensive heat-treating, tempering, and shot-peening processes to ensure consistent strength and durability. They are also magna-fluxed to verify integrity and adherence to stringent quality specifications.

Key Features:

  • Length: 13435mm
  • Precision Machined 3/8-Inch ARP2000/Skunk2 bolts
  • Shot-peened for reduced fatigue
  • Bronze wrist pin bushings
  • Laser-etched Skunk2 logo for authenticity
  • Fatter, H-beam design without drastic weight increase
  • Pin end compatible with most pistons without machining
  • Dual-pin oil passages for increased lubrication and strength
  • 900+ hp capable
  • Balanced +/- 1 gram
  • Magna-flux inspected
  • Heat-treated
  • FEA analyzed

3. Setup and Installation

Installation of performance engine components like connecting rods requires specialized knowledge, tools, and experience. It is highly recommended that installation be performed by a certified professional automotive technician.

General Guidelines:

  1. Preparation: Ensure the engine block, crankshaft, and pistons are thoroughly cleaned and inspected for any damage or wear. All mating surfaces must be free of debris.
  2. Component Inspection: Before installation, carefully inspect each connecting rod for any signs of shipping damage or manufacturing defects. Verify that the bronze wrist pin bushings are properly seated.
  3. Lubrication: Apply appropriate assembly lubricant to all bearing surfaces, wrist pins, and connecting rod bolts as specified by engine building best practices.
  4. Torque Specifications: Adhere strictly to the manufacturer's torque specifications for the connecting rod bolts. Over- or under-tightening can lead to catastrophic engine failure. Use a calibrated torque wrench.
  5. Clearances: Verify all critical clearances, including rod bearing clearance, side clearance, and piston-to-valve clearance, using precision measuring tools.
  6. Balancing: While Skunk2 Alpha Series rods are balanced to +/- 1 gram, for optimal performance in high-revving engines, consider having the rotating assembly (crankshaft, rods, pistons) professionally balanced.

Warning: Improper installation can lead to severe engine damage, personal injury, or death. Skunk2 Racing is not responsible for damages resulting from incorrect installation.

6. Troubleshooting

Connecting rod issues typically manifest as severe engine problems. Due to the critical nature of these components, any suspected issue requires immediate professional attention.

Common Symptoms of Potential Issues (Requires Professional Diagnosis):

  • Knocking or Tapping Noises: A distinct knocking sound, especially from the lower end of the engine, can indicate worn rod bearings or other connecting rod issues.
  • Loss of Oil Pressure: A sudden or significant drop in oil pressure can be a symptom of severe bearing wear.
  • Metal Shavings in Oil: The presence of metallic particles in engine oil (visible on the dipstick or drain plug magnet) is a strong indicator of internal component wear, including bearings.
  • Engine Seizure: In extreme cases, a failed connecting rod or bearing can lead to complete engine seizure.

Important: Do not attempt to diagnose or repair internal engine issues without proper training and tools. Continuing to operate an engine with suspected connecting rod problems can lead to irreversible damage.
